> > Log:
> >   Remove all the checks on curthread != NULL with the exception of some MD
> >   trap checks (eg. printtrap()).
> >   
> >   Generally this check is not needed anymore, as there is not a legitimate
> >   case where curthread != NULL, after pcpu 0 area has been properly
> >   initialized.
> I do not disagree with the patch, but I do with this statement.
> During the AP startup, there is indeed a window while curthread is NULL.
> Unfortunately, trying to panic there is worse then not panic.

Also during early BSP startup.  On x86 very early faults actually result in a 
BTX fault rather than a panic since we run with BTX's IDT for a bit in locore, 
etc.
